Job Description - AFTER SCHOOL- Spanish Language Instructor



Part-time


Description

Live Oak is accepting resumes for an After School Spanish Language instructor. This position will teach after school Spanish to students in kindergarten through eighth grades.

Applicants should have experience as classroom instructors, professional training, enjoy collaborative work, demonstrate a commitment to issues of equity and social justice, and feel a resonance with the school’s mission, vision, values, and facilitate the well-being of the students in a fun, structured and supportive after school environment. Primary Responsibilities:

  • The After School Spanish Language instructor is responsible for the planning and implementation of the Live Oak School After School Spanish program, following the school’s educational philosophy, establishing scope and sequence, and adopted resources.
  • Develop and implement robust assessment practices; provide regular feedback to students.
  • Lead daily academic and enrichment activities
  • Language instruction that builds upon the Spanish language learning objectives.
  • Cultivate active, ongoing communication with parents and the school community.
  • Mediate disputes using conflict resolution strategies.
  • Maintain school facilities in an orderly and well-kept manner
  • Estimated course load: Teach two group classes for second through eighth graders (2 sessions per week) as well as one-on-one private language lessons.
  • Collaborate with the Program Coordinator and the Director of Extended Day Programs in providing students with academic and social support.

Requirements

Qualifications:

  • Minimum of two years of proven experience working with school-age students, ages 5-14.
  • You are available to work between 3:00- 6:00 p.m., Monday through Friday, immediately to mid-May 2027.
  • Understanding of youth development principles.
  • Able to work independently, take initiative, be flexible, and be adaptable to a variety of jobs.
  • Demonstrate ability to work effectively in collaboration with others.
  • Experience tutoring, creating, and leading daily activities.

Compensation for this position: $100-$150 per hour, DOE.
